Search for: [Abstract = "The aim of the interview was to select and interpret the main topics associated by individuals with the issues of overweight and underweight and their cultural meanings. The analysis shows that cultural meanings of opposite categories \"slim\" \- \"obese\" are significantly connected with gender\: the assessment of who is slim and who is obese depends not only on the sexes of the observing and observed individuals, but is also conditioned by a number of assumptions on the perception of roles connected with sex, socially perceived ideals of a beautiful and attractive body, and also stereotypes of femininity and masculinity."]
